Package Info<br />

Package Info is used to specify the general extension <strong>info</strong>rmation such as name,<br />

description, and versions of Magento that are supported, as follows:<br />

• Name: The standard practice is to keep the name simple and using<br />

just words<br />

• Channel: This refers to the code pool for the extension; as we mentioned in<br />

the previous chapters, extensions designed for distribution should use the<br />

"commun<strong>it</strong>y" channel<br />

• Supported releases: Select which version of Magento should be supported<br />

for our extension<br />

• Summary: This field contains a brief description of the extension used on the<br />

extension review process<br />

• Description: This has a detailed description of the extension and<br />

<strong>it</strong>s functional<strong>it</strong>y<br />

• License: This has the license used for this extension; some of the available<br />

options are:<br />

° ° Open Software License (OSL)<br />

° ° Mozilla Public License (MPL)<br />

° ° Massachusetts Inst<strong>it</strong>ute of Technology License (MITL)<br />

° ° GNU General Public License (GPL)<br />

° ° Any other license if your extension is to be distributed commercially<br />

• License URI: This has the link to the license text<br />
